Getting to the ferry ports in Amorgos
To reach Katapola, Amorgos ports, you'll find the ferry terminal located conveniently near the village center, just a short walk from local shops and restaurants, making it easily accessible for travelers. The closest major airport is on the island of Naxos, approximately a 1.5-hour ferry ride away. From Naxos, you can take a ferry directly to Katapola, with services typically operating multiple times a day.
For transportation options, you can arrive by car or taxi, or utilize local buses that connect Katapola to other areas on the island. Taxis are available at key points, with a short ride from the nearby town of Chora taking about 15 minutes. Public buses from Chora to Katapola run regularly, ensuring you have reliable transport to the port.
In Rethymno, Crete, the ferry terminal is situated along the waterfront, close to the old town, and just a 10-minute walk from the main bus station. This makes it well-connected to key areas for anyone traveling to or from the island.

Make the most of your time in Rethymno, Crete
Rethymno, Crete is a beautiful place that everyone should visit! It has stunning beaches where you can build sandcastles and swim in clear blue waters. One of the coolest spots is the old town, filled with colorful buildings, little shops, and yummy cafes. You can try delicious local food like moussaka and fresh seafood.
Don’t miss the Venetian Fortress, a big castle with amazing views! It's fun to walk around and learn about history. There are also secret gems like the lovely Arkadi Monastery, which is peaceful and full of stories. Nature lovers will enjoy hiking in the beautiful mountains or visiting the amazing Preveli Beach with its palm trees.
Rethymno is perfect for a short visit, but it’s also a great starting point to explore other nearby places and islands. Whether you're adventuring or relaxing by the sea, Rethymno has something special for everyone!
